- The distance between Cape Carbonara, Italy and Takamatsu, Japan is approximately 10,057 km or 6,250 mi.
- To reach Cape Carbonara in this distance one would set out from Takamatsu bearing 320.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Cape Carbonara bearing 222.9° or SW .
- Cape Carbonara has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Takamatsu has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The annual average temperature is 2.3 °C (4.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.5 °C (15.3°F) less in Cape Carbonara.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 881.6 mm (34.7 in) less which is equivalent to 881.6 l/m² (21.64 US gal/ft²) or 8,816,000 l/ha (942,489 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.8° lower in Cape Carbonara than in Takamatsu.
- Relative humidity levels are 2.2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 2.6°C (4.6°F) higher.
